Underground Blast
(N.Z. Press Assn.—Copyright) UPPSALA, (Sweden), July 20
. A third underground explosion in Siberia in 18 weeks was registered by the Uppsala Seismological Institute yesterday, the Associated Press reported. The first took place on March 15. the second on May 16. The institute said it could not tell whether they were nuclear underground blasts or “ordinary chemical explosions.” All the explosions have taken place in the Semipalatinsk area in Siberia. 1
